Summary
ipmi-oem in FreeIPMI before 1.6.19 has a stack-based buffer over-read in ipmi_oem_fujitsu_get_sel_entry_long_text in ipmi-oem/ipmi-oem-fujitsu.c when a BMC provides a short response, a different vulnerability than CVE-2026-50031 (which has different affected versions).
Severity
7.5 (High)
CWE
- CWE-125 - Out-of-bounds Read
